Under the general direction of the Onsite Leadership team, this position supports the growth of the onsite business by driving profitable sales growth and customer service through understanding.

Responsibilities
  • Interact, respond and follow up with customers on a daily basis, promptly responding to all inquiries in a courteous and efficient manner
  • Sell a diversified line of products over-the-counter promoting Private Brands, Technical Services and ecommerce channels whenever possible and provide an understanding of the Grainger Value Proposition to customers
  • Process customer orders through the computer system, ensuring accuracy and prompt delivery
  • Maintain a well-rounded knowledge of products sold including the completion of the required training programs
  • Provide branch support including supporting warehouse functions as required
  • Assist in driving the achievement of key operational metrics in customer satisfaction, sales, safety, and operational improvements by utilizing available tools and reporting
  • Utilize sound judgment and best practices to resolve complex customer concerns
  • Participate in Continuous Improvement (CI) Team meetings and CI on-site initiatives as required
  • Demonstrate a strong commitment to personal safety and safety in the workplace
  • Perform other duties and responsibilities as required for the position
